Grand Rapids & WeCare Denali | Grand Rapids, MI

The Team: This team is a collaboration between the city of Grand Rapids and WeCare Denali. Grand Rapids is located in west-central Michigan, roughly 30 miles east of Lake Michigan, with a population of approximately 197,000 people. WeCare Denali is one of the largest organics and residual management companies in the US with operations across the country, including locations in Grand Rapids and Ann Arbor, Michigan.

NextCycle Michigan Project:  The city of Grand Rapids has ambitions to develop a food scrap drop-off pilot program. The city would partner with community gardens and farmer’s markets to host collection sites. Once collected, the material would be brought to the city’s current compost facility, operated by WeCare Denali. There, the food scraps would be made into viable finished compost to be distributed locally at community gardens and other city or local projects. After the initial pilot, the program could expand to include pre-consumer commercial food scraps and wood recycling – including wood waste from surrounding cities. During NextCycle Michigan, the team will work with coaches to calculate realistic metrics for diversion, develop a business plan for incoming and outgoing products, and identify and prepare for funding pathways. This project will divert materials from landfills, improve soil health, reduce greenhouse gas emissions, and create jobs.
